Sr.front-end Ui Developer Resume
Irvine, CA
SUMMARY
- More than 7 years’ experience in front end development and web design responsible on working with implementing, designing, planning for different web applications projects
- Experience in designing User Interface (UI) applications and professional web applications using HTML 4.0/5, XHTML, CSS2/CSS3, SASS, JavaScript, and jQuery, Ajax, JSON and XML.
- Experienced in using Web Standards.
- Responsible for checking cross browser compatibility and hence worked on different browsers like Safari, Internet Explorer, Mozilla Firefox and Google chrome.
- Expert in converting PSD mockup that given by designers to HTML, CSS prototype using Hardcoding using Sublime text Editor
- Proficient in creating responsive web websites that work properly on different screen sizes like
- (Mobile, Tablets, Ipads, Small laptops, Large screens) using CSS3 Media queries breakpoints and Bootstrap grid system.
- Extensive experience creating well - organize CSS files by using Sass & Less frameworks to avoid CSS repetition.
- Decent understanding for Object-oriented programming concept as well as MVC frameworks concepts
- Expert in Restful services using Get, Post, Delete, Put methods While accessing external API
- Worked extensively in Agile Development process.
- Highly Curious about new front-end development technologies and adept at promptly and thoroughly mastering them with a keen awareness of new industry developments and the evolution of programming solutions.
- Produced visually appealing designs focused on usability, utility, UX, cross-browser compatibility and SEO / web standards.
- Good Understanding of Document Object Model (DOM) and DOM Functions.
- Expertise in Client Side designing and validations using HTML, DHTML and JavaScript, jQuery.
- Experience with Firebug for Mozilla and IE Developer Toolbar for Internet Explorer.
- Experience on large scale JavaScript projects / Front End Development.
- Experienced in Designing table-less layouts.
- Experience in creating and consuming Web Services.
- Excellent interpersonal abilities, communication skills, time management and team skills with an intention to work hard to attain project deadlines under stressful environments.
- Experience managing daily communication with an OffShore development team.
- Involved in Understanding functional specifications and developing creative solutions to meet business requirements.
- Worked closely with the project management and marketing team to completely define specifications to help ensure project acceptance
TECHNICAL SKILLS
Web Technologies: HTML/HTML5, CSS/CSS3, SASS, XML, XHTML, Java, JDK, JavaScript Ajax, jQuery, JSON, Bootstrap, Apache.
JavaScript Libraries: AngularJS, NodeJS, ExpressJS, Backbones, RequireJs.
IDE’s and Tools: Dreamweaver, Visual Studio, Sublime text, eclipse IDE
Database: PL/SQL (oracle), MySQL, SQL Server 2008.
Debugging Tools: Firebug, Bugzilla
Operating System: Windows XP/Vista/7/8, MAC OS X
PROFESSIONAL EXPERIENCE
Confidential, Irvine, CA
Sr.Front-End UI Developer
Responsibilities:
- Responsible for creating efficient design and developing User Interaction screens using HTML5, CSS3, SASS, JavaScript, jQuery, Ajax and JSON.
- Worked on creating responsive website for smart devices using responsive design and media queries.
- Used AngularJS as framework to create a Single Page Application (SPA) which can bind data to specific views and synchronize data with server.
- Used two way data Binding techniques and custom filters.
- Extensively worked on Rest Services and dependency injection.
- Used requires to load modules in JavaScript files.
- Utilized various JavaScript and jQuery libraries, Ajax for form validation and other interactive features.
- Created Angular JS controllers, services and used Angular JS filters for filter functionality in search box and integrator functionalities.
- Used Ajax, JSON to send request to the server to check the functionality of the websites.
- Created various Mixins, Variables, Custom Fonts and Directives in SASS.
- Developed pie charts using Google Charts for web application that matched the requirements.
- Implemented applications using Twitter Bootstrap framework to create responsive web design.
- Testing the website on multiple browsers with their old as well as latest release.
- Used Grunt to compile Sass files.
- Used JSON for storing and exchanging information between browsers and servers.
- Worked closely with QA team in fixing the reported bugs/defects and checking cross platform compatibility.
- Active participation throughout the entire software development lifecycle from project inception, to code development and elaborate testing of the various modules.
- Involved in Agile/SCRUM based approach to UI Development.
- Used CSS Sprites to decrease the number of HTTP requests and load time of web pages.
- Been an active team player, helped in fixing bugs and also carried out troubleshooting.
Environment: HTML5, CSS3, JavaScript, JQuery, SASS, Angular JS, Ajax, JSON, Visual Studio, Bootstrap, Google Charts.
Confidential
Sr. Web Application Developer
Responsibilities:
- Coordinated project activities and ensure that all project phases are followed and documented properly.
- Extensively involved design discussions and user experience sessions to provide inputs on the layout and UX.
- Designed the front-end applications, user interactive (UI) web pages using web technologies like HTML, XHTML, CSS, JavaScript and jQuery.
- Developed non-functional HTML, CSS pages from the mock ups and involved in UI review with UI architect and Business Units.
- Developed GUI using Backbone.js, JavaScript, HTML/HTML5, DOM, Ajax, CSS3 and jQuery, jQuery Mobile in on-going projects.
- Used Bootstrap for Responsiveness.
- Used JQuery for creating various widgets, data manipulation, data traversing, form validations, create the content on the fly depend on the user request, implementing Ajax features for the application.
- Converted the mock-ups into hand-written HTML, CSS (2/3), JavaScript, jQuery, Ajax, XML and JSON.
- Improved user experience by designing and creating new web components and features.
- Involved in complete SDLC - Requirement Analysis, Development, System and Integration Testing.
- Widely used optimization techniques in existing code.
- Handling cross browser/platform compatibility issues (IE, Firefox, and Safari) on both Windows and Mac.
- Experience in making responsive web pages using Twitter Bootstrap and Media queries.
- Tested/De-bugged on browser using Firebug
- Managed application state using server and client-based State Management options.
- Coded Java Script for page functionality and Light box plugins using jQuery.
- Coordinated project activities and ensure that all project phases are followed and documented properly.
- Extensively involved design discussions and user experience sessions to provide inputs on the layout and UX.
Environment: HTML/DHTML, CSS, JavaScript, jQuery, Bootstrap, Backbone.js, Ajax, JSON, SVN
Confidential, San Diego, CA
UI Developer
Responsibilities:
- Deep understanding of JavaScript and the JQuery framework
- Elegant implementation of page designs instandards-compliantHTML and CSS.
- Used AJAX and JSON to make asynchronous calls to the project server to fetch data on the fly.
- Designed CSS based page layouts that arecross-browsercompatible on all the major browsers like Safari, Chrome, Firefox and IE.
- Responsible for fixing all bugs encountered and communicating them back over to the QA team.
- Implemented various Validation Controls for form validation and implemented custom validation controls with JavaScript validation controls.
- Used JSON for data transfer between front end and back end.
- Converted the Photoshop mockups in tohand-writtenHTML and CSS pages.
- Developed web pages applying best standards.
- Responsible for creating the screens withtable-lessdesigns meeting W3C standards.
- Applied JQuery scripts for basic animation and end user screen customization purposes
Environment: HTML, CSS, JavaScript, JQuery, AJAX, Eclipse, MS Office, Adobe Photoshop, MS Excel.
Confidential, Atlanta, GA
UI Developer
Responsibilities:
- Working with Agile methodology including Grooming session meetings and user stories planning and estimation.
- Working of using gulp task runner and writing units testing using Jasmine.
- Working in end to end testing using Protractor.
- Experience working with npm to install independences and running the project on a local server for development purposes using live-server.
- Developed Web applications using JavaScript, MVC client side validation using JavaScript.
- Using HTML powerful features like local storage, Web Workers, embedding video and Audio.
- Programmed standards complaint HTML and CSS working with JQuery library modules and JavaScript framework libraries.
- Made changes to various CSS properties to enhance the UI as per client requirements.
- Developed securing the application usingform-basedauthentication using HTML, JavaScript, JQuery and CSS.
- Used Sublime text for writing code, Used Tomcat for deploying various components of application.
- Developed Web applications using JavaScript, MVC client side validation using JavaScript.
Environment: HTML, CSS, JavaScript, Unit Testing, JSON, Restful service